19 abr 1775 ano - Lexington and Concord
Descrição:
The British Army had intended to capture rebel leaders Samuel Adams and John Hancock in Lexington and destroy the Americans store of weapons and ammunition in Concord. But, the night before riders, like Paul Revere, went out and warned the colonists that the British were coming. Sam Adams and John Hancock escaped and they were able to hid some of the weapons.
